Dashboard
Blocks
Transactions
Explorer API
Address
33aPgEcM3ZtNfjr3o2PrXgFFH8tYNRaw42
Confirmed tx count
26
Confirmed received
13 outputs (0.42264673 BTC)
Confirmed spent
13 outputs (0.42264673 BTC)
Confirmed unspent
No outputs
25-26 of 26 Transactions
31d648f49398ea5a1441dc9b065736ac10c7229c764235386d33e8e35870ff7f
Details
4160264c1a9732c952c079bab9ecb1c5d21dc5c386cbba23c881e183d578d5f4:0
0.05200727 BTC
13L3NzH7HYCEuJ5cTzyTq5oyZKnhtcTewb
0.00831168 BTC
33aPgEcM3ZtNfjr3o2PrXgFFH8tYNRaw42
0.04354125 BTC
Newer